General Information
Title: Farewell, my joy
Composer: Thomas Weelkes
Number of voices: 5vv Voicing: SSATB
Genre: Secular, Madrigal
Language: English
Instruments: a cappella

Original text and translations
English text
Farewell my joy, adieu my love and pleasure.
To sport and toy we have no longer leisure,
Fa la la
Farewell, farewell, adieu, adieu, until our next consorting.
Sweet love, be true, and thus we end our sporting.
Fa la la
